University of Science and Arts of Oklahoma Services

The Basics

Basic services offered: nonremedial tutoring, placement service, health service
Remedial services: reading, math, writing, study skills, other
Counseling availability: minority student, career, military, personal, veteran student, academic, older student, birth control

Career Potential

Career advising services: on-campus job interviews, internships, resume assistance, interest inventory, interview training, other
Percent of graduates employed after 6 months: 75%
Percent of graduates employed after 1 year: 90%
Percent of graduates employed after 2 years: $95%
Main employers of graduates: FAA, Devon Oil, Industry Systems
